Manchester Cit boss, Pep Guardiola has set the date he would leave the Premier League.
Guardiola has enjoyed overwhelming success at the Etihad since joining in the summer of 2016.
But now the Spaniard appears to have ruled out staying on at the club beyond the end of his current deal, and is set to depart in 2025, according to the Guardian.
The seven years that the 52-year-old has spent at the Etihad thus far were already unexpected, with many at the club anticipating an exit at the end of his initial three-year deal.
A further extension was signed in November, tying him down to the Citizens for another two-and-a-half years, bringing his stay to a close at the end of the 2024-25 season.
Should Guardiola depart, he will leave as one of the most successful managers English football has ever seen, winning five Premier Leagues, two FA Cups, Four Carabao Cups and of course this season’s Champions League in seven years.
